A comprehensive look at what changes when you move from Azerbaijan to Mauritius — from daily expenses to quality of life.

If you moved from Azerbaijan to Mauritius, you would find that Mauritius is 46.2% more expensive than Azerbaijan overall. A AZN127,500 salary in Azerbaijan would need to be roughly MUR4,517,703 in Mauritius to maintain the same lifestyle, and you’d need to navigate life in English, French and Mauritian Creole. You’ll also switch from driving on the right to the left. Expect a noticeable climate shift — Port Louis averages 85°F vs 65°F in Baku, making it significantly warmer.

Visitor Visa Requirements

Short-stay tourist visa rules between Azerbaijan and Mauritius. To live, work, or study long-term in Mauritius, you'll need a separate residence or work visa — check Mauritius's immigration authority.

Azerbaijan passport

Azerbaijan passport holder visiting Mauritius

Visa on Arrival
Azerbaijan passport holders can obtain a visa on arrival in Mauritius.
Mauritius passport

Mauritius passport holder visiting Azerbaijan

Visa Online (e-Visa)
Mauritius passport holders need to apply for an e-Visa before travelling to Azerbaijan.

Data: Henley Passport Index. Check with the destination country's embassy for the most current requirements.

What's the weather like in Mauritius compared to Azerbaijan?

The average high temperature in Port Louis is 85°F, compared to 65°F in Baku. Port Louis receives around 28.0 in of rainfall per year, while Baku gets 8.3 in.

What language do they speak in Mauritius?

The official languages in Mauritius are English, French and Mauritian Creole. In Azerbaijan, the official language is Azerbaijani.
